How to Solve Color Mark Detection Challenges on Carton Production Lines?
The printing and cutting station is a core process of corrugated cardboard production. The equipment needs to accurately identify color marks on cardboard to trigger cutting operations, ensuring consistent dimensions and precise cutting of finished products. The stability of color mark detection directly affects production efficiency and yield rate.
Detection Requirements
Accurately identify the presence of color marks on corrugated cardboard and trigger cutting immediately upon detection. Adapt to high-speed production, realize synchronous cutting and conveying with zero delay and offset.

Application Challenges
Corrugated cardboards come in various base colors, which easily interfere with color mark recognition. The surface film on cardboard causes strong reflection, leading to false detection and missed detection by conventional sensors. High-speed production imposes stringent requirements on sensor response speed and operational stability.
Solution
Install the EB-WC4 integrated high-speed color mark sensor at the hollow section of the conveyor ahead of the cutting blade. It performs real-time detection of color marks and outputs signals instantly to drive precise cutting.

Core Product Advantages
Automatic RGB Light Selection: Intelligently adapts to diverse base colors and filmed surfaces for reliable color mark positioning.
High-Speed Response: Features a 20μs response time and 25kHz operating frequency, fully compatible with high-speed production lines.
RS485 Communication Support: Ensures stable data transmission for easy line integration and remote commissioning.
High Resolution: Recognizes subtle color differences effectively, eliminating misjudgment caused by base color and surface reflection.
Application Results
It delivers stable color mark detection on multi-color cardboards and film-covered surfaces. The sensor responds promptly at high operating speeds to achieve perfectly synchronized cutting, drastically reducing waste and rework. Its all-in-one design enables easy installation and quick commissioning for fast deployment.
